The Permanent Representative of Pakistan to the UN, Ambassador Kamran Akhtar, led the Pakistan delegation to the extraordinary session of IAEA’s Board of Governors held on 23 June 2025. His Excellency Ambassador further stated that in order to uphold the role of the Agency as well as the integrity and credibility of the IAEA safeguards and UN system, it was imperative to prevent states from taking Unilateral actions to deal with compliance issues through use of force. He added that it was the responsibility of the Board to deal strictly with unilateral actions that further undermine international order. The meeting was convened by DG IAEA in wake of US attacks on Iran’s peaceful and safeguarded nuclear facilities. The PR highlighted Pakistan’s principled position on inadmissibility of attacks or threats of attack against nuclear facilities.
